Overview
Liverpool John Moores University International Study Centre are recruiting an Engineering Maths Tutor to join the existing teaching team. The successful candidate will teach modules in engineering and maths related subjects to students on university preparation programmes offered by the Centre. This is a part-time, variable hours – permanent contract with a salary of £38.27 per hour.
